Filing History
8 filings on record| Year | Revenue | Expenses | Assets | |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 2023 | $325,133↑32% | $275,120↑8% | $152,098↑49% | — |
| 2022 | $246,314↓31% | $255,099↑1% | $102,085↓8% | — |
| 2021 | $356,595↑64% | $253,120↑20% | $110,870↑1399% | — |
| 2020 | $218,050↓7% | $211,424↓9% | $7,395↑862% | — |
| 2019 | $234,565↓2% | $233,444↓4% | $769↑318% | — |
| 2018 | $239,805↑13% | $243,302↑16% | -$352↓111% | — |
| 2017 | $211,977↑4% | $209,534↑3% | $3,145↑149% | — |
| 2016 | $203,690 | $202,988 | $1,264 | — |

What does Center For Exceptional Families do?▼
Center For Exceptional Families is a civil rights, social action & advocacy nonprofit organization based in Arkansas. It is classified under NTEE code R23 and is registered as a 501(c) tax-exempt organization with the IRS.
